Как создавать веб-сайты и какими средствами?

Создание веб-сайтов стало неотъемлемой частью жизни современных пользователей. С каждым годом растет число людей, заинтересованных в создании личных и бизнес проектов в интернете. Но с чего начать, какие инструменты выбрать, чтобы этот процесс прошел максимально гладко? В нашем материале мы рассмотрим основные варианты, которые помогут вам реализовать свои идеи.

Существует множество платформ и утилит, доступных для создания сайтов. Каждая из них имеет свои преимущества и особенности. Важно выбрать те инструменты, которые будут соответствовать вашим целям и навыкам. Например, для новичков подойдут редакторы с простым интерфейсом, в то время как более опытные разработчики могут обратиться к сложным системам, предоставляющим широкий спектр возможностей.

Мы проанализируем, какие приложения и технологии наиболее популярны среди средних и крупных разработчиков, а также обсудим плюсы и минусы различных решений. Понимание этих аспектов поможет вам сориентироваться и сделать правильный выбор в процессе создания вашего веб-продукта.

Создание веб-сайтов: какими инструментами пользоваться

Для программистов, предпочтительными являются языки разметки и программирования. HTML и CSS составляют основу любого веб-сайта, отвечая за структуру и стиль. JavaScript позволяет добавлять интерактивные элементы, делая сайт более привлекательным для пользователей.

Не стоит забывать о фреймворках, таких как React, Angular и Vue.js. Эти инструменты помогают ускорить процесс разработок веб-приложений, предлагая готовые компоненты и архитектурные решения. Для серверной части можно использовать Node.js, Ruby on Rails или PHP.

Кроме разработки, важна и оптимизация. Google Analytics и SEMrush помогут отслеживать трафик и оптимизировать сайт для поисковых систем. Для создания привлекательного дизайна существуют такие инструменты, как Figma и Adobe XD, которые упрощают процесс проектирования интерфейса.

Таким образом, возможностей для создания веб-сайтов много. Используя правильные инструменты, можно сделать процесс разработки более простым и интересным.

Выбор платформы для разработки веб-сайта

При создании веб-сайта важно правильно выбрать платформу, которая обеспечит нужные функции и возможности. Ниже представлены основные типы платформ, которые могут подойти для различных проектов.

  • CMS (Системы управления контентом)
    • WordPress — популярная система для блогов и сайтов различной сложности.
    • Joomla — подходит для более сложных проектов с большим количеством контента.
    • Drupal — обеспечивает высокий уровень настройки и безопасности.
  • Конструкторы сайтов
    • Wix — интуитивно понятный интерфейс и готовые шаблоны.
    • Squarespace — акцент на дизайне и визуальной эстетике.
    • Weebly — подходит для быстрого создания простых сайтов.
  • Фреймворки для разработки
    • React — библиотека для построения пользовательских интерфейсов.
    • Angular — платформа для создания одностраничных приложений.
    • Vue.js — гибкий и простой в изучении фреймворк.
  • Серверные технологии
    • Node.js — позволяет создавать серверные приложения на JavaScript.
    • Ruby on Rails — предоставляет средства для быстрой разработки веб-приложений.
    • PHP — часто используется для динамических сайтов и веб-приложений.

При выборе платформы учтите следующие факторы:

  1. Цели проекта — определи, какую функциональность должен иметь сайт.
  2. Уровень опыта — выберите платформу, соответствующую вашим навыкам.
  3. Бюджет — учтите затраты на разработку и обслуживание.
  4. Поддержка и сообщество — наличие ресурсов и документации может облегчить решение проблем.

Хороший выбор платформы повлияет на успех вашего веб-сайта. Уделите время изучению доступных опций и определите, какая из них лучше всего подходит для вашего проекта.

Использование фреймворков для ускорения разработки

Фреймворки представляют собой наборы библиотек и инструментов, которые помогают разработчикам создавать веб-сайты быстрее и удобнее. Они обеспечивают стандартизированные методы для выполнения распространенных задач, таких как работа с маршрутизацией, обработкой данных и взаимодействием с базами данных.

Одним из главных преимуществ применения фреймворков является возможность многократного использования кода. Вместо того чтобы писать повторяющиеся участки кода, разработчики могут использовать уже готовые решения, что сокращает время разработки и уменьшает вероятность ошибок.

Фреймворки также часто имеют встроенные инструменты для тестирования и отладки, что упрощает процесс поиска и устранения проблем. Это помогает поддерживать качество кода и повышает надежность конечного продукта.

Некоторые из популярных фреймворков включают React, Angular, Vue.js для фронтенда и Django, Ruby on Rails, Laravel для бэкенда. Каждый из них предлагает уникальные возможности, подходящие для различных проектов.

Использование фреймворков не только ускоряет процесс разработки, но и способствует созданию более структурированного и поддерживаемого кода, что особенно важно при работе над крупными проектами с участием нескольких разработчиков.

Инструменты для тестирования и оптимизации сайта

Тестирование и оптимизация сайта играют важную роль в обеспечении его производительности и удобства пользования. Существует множество инструментов, которые помогут вам улучшить эти аспекты.

Google PageSpeed Insights – сервис, который анализирует производительность вашей страницы на мобильных и десктопных устройствах. Он предоставляет рекомендации по улучшению загрузки и оптимизации контента.

GTmetrix – этот инструмент позволяет проверить скорость загрузки сайта и предлагает подробные отчеты о том, что можно исправить. Также доступна функция мониторинга производительности на протяжении времени.

Pingdom – предлагает анализ времени загрузки, а также различные метрики, такие как размер страницы и количество запросов. Удобный интерфейс позволяет быстро понять, где находятся узкие места.

Crazy Egg – фокусируется на визуализации поведения пользователей на сайте. Тепловые карты и записи сессий показывают, как посетители взаимодействуют с элементами интерфейса, что позволяет выявить проблемные зоны.

Ahrefs и SEMrush – инструменты для SEO-оптимизации. Они помогают анализировать трафик, проводить аудит сайта, оптимизировать ключевые слова и контролировать позиции в поисковых системах.

Для автоматизированного тестирования также подойдут Selenium и Jest, которые позволяют проверять функциональность и производительность веб-приложений.

Выбор соответствующих инструментов зависит от ваших целей и задач. Комплексный подход к тестированию и оптимизации поможет добиться хороших результатов в работе вашего сайта.

FAQ

Какие бесплатные инструменты можно использовать для создания веб-сайтов?

Существует множество бесплатных инструментов для создания веб-сайтов. Один из самых популярных — это WordPress, который предлагает гибкость благодаря множеству тем и плагинов. Также стоит обратить внимание на конструкторы сайтов, такие как Wix и Weebly, которые предлагают простые в использовании интерфейсы и возможность создания сайтов без глубоких технических знаний. GitHub Pages позволяет хостить статические сайты и идеально подходит для разработчиков, знакомых с Git. Все эти инструменты обеспечивают различные функции, которые помогают создать сайт на любой вкус.

Как выбрать правильный инструмент для создания веб-сайта?

Выбор инструмента зависит от ваших потребностей и уровня подготовки. Если вы новичок, вам подойдет конструктор, такой как Wix или Squarespace, так как они предлагают интуитивно понятные интерфейсы и шаблоны. Если у вас есть опыт в программировании, можете рассмотреть CMS, такие как Joomla или Drupal, которые более гибкие и позволяют настроить сайт под свои требования. Также важно учитывать бюджет: есть платные и бесплатные варианты, так что выбирайте тот, который соответствует вашим финансовым возможностям. И, наконец, подумайте о цели вашего сайта: для бизнеса, блога или портфолио, так как это может повлиять на ваш выбор инструмента.

Какое значение имеет хостинг при создании сайта и как его выбрать?

Хостинг играет ключевую роль в создании веб-сайта, так как именно на сервере размещаются все файлы вашего сайта. При выборе хостинга необходимо учитывать несколько факторов: скорость, надежность и уровень поддержки. Популярные провайдеры, такие как Bluehost или SiteGround, предлагают различные планы, которые варьируются по цене и возможностям. Также стоит обратить внимание на местоположение серверов, так как это может сказаться на скорости загрузки сайта для пользователей. Если вы ожидаете большой объем трафика, выбирайте хостинг с возможностью масштабирования. Наконец, подумайте о типе хостинга: общий, VPS или выделенный, в зависимости от ваших нужд и бюджета.

Оцените статью
Добавить комментарий